Definition

  1. 1
    A steam-powered heavy road roller.
  2. 2
    Any heavy road roller.
  3. 3
    Any seemingly irresistible force.
  4. 4
    A pipe, used for smoking cannabis, open at both ends and having a bowl near one end.

Etymology

From steam + roller.
